The Controversial 'Widow's Tax' Explained
The government faced a massive wave of criticism after proposing changes to pension and compensation schemes that critics quickly dubbed a 'widow's tax.' The policy aimed to alter how payments were distributed to surviving spouses, potentially stripping thousands of dollars away from grieving partners who relied on that money to survive. For many families, these payments aren't a luxury; they are a critical lifeline used to cover mortgages, bills, and everyday living costs during an incredibly difficult transition period.
Why the Public Backlash Forced a U-Turn
The community response was swift and uncompromising. Veterans' groups, advocacy organizations, and everyday citizens voiced their outrage over what they saw as an unfair penalty on people who had already sacrificed so much. Media scrutiny intensified the pressure, highlighting individual stories of widows who would be pushed into financial hardship under the new rules. Recognizing the immense political damage and the genuine harm the policy would cause, the Labor government announced a total backdown, shelving the proposed changes entirely.
